Product Description

This first edition is now out of print and has been superceded by a second revised edition (Arrivals and Rivals - A duel for the winning bird, ISBN-13: 978-0954334796) with a new strap line, along with a stunning new 'Firebird' cover, more colour photos and an extra chapter on how to prepare for such fantastic, madcap adventures. Adrian Riley provides with his book entertaining and highly illuminating insights into the obsessions and passions when he set out to become the nationally recognised 'Birder of the Year'. Here is a classic tale, set amidst the beautiful British countryside, involving a rivalry so strong that all else is forgotten - save the birds and the desire to see them, despite the many costs both mentally and physically.

4.0 out of 5 stars The (Superior?) British Big Year, 19 Dec 2005
By S. L. Quinn "Occasional Reviewer!" (Gateshead, Co. Durham) - See all my reviews
(REAL NAME)   
I read this book in a couple of sittings (always a good sign). Having read the American-based Big Year, I had wondered about UK equivalent, when I was told about this. The birds (well most of them) the locations and the emotions were more familiar to me than the other version.

Are these obsessive types loveable? - they seem hard work, or perhaps in their pursuit of victory, being social isn't on the agenda. That said, the character's seem warmer than their US counterparts and while it might come across and great v evil - the winner is the reader. Sufficient to interest the reader on several levels, it entertained a (relative) newcomer and birder of limited ability to such an extent that I will year list, and travel miles to see birds, but not exclusively for the sake of each other!

Any birder, twitcher, lister or wannabee might care to read this to see the rules.

Classic? no - entertaining, oh yes!
